ENGLISH Water connection • Make sure not to cause damage to the water hoses. • The appliance is to be connected to the water mains using the new supplied hose-sets. Old hose sets must not be reused. • Before you connect the appliance to new pipes or pipes not used for a long time, let the water flow until it is clean. • The first time you use the appliance, make sure that there is no leakage. 2.2 Use WARNING! ENGLISH 13 • Position A for powder detergent (factory setting). • Position B for liquid detergent. When you use the liquid detergent: – Do not use gelatinous or thick liquid detergents. – Do not put more liquid then the maximum level. – Do not set the prewash phase. – Do not set the delay start. 9.3 Setting a programme 1. www.aeg.com Open the appliance door when the delay start operates: 1. Press the Start/Pause to pause the appliance. 2. Wait until the door lock indicator goes off. 3. You can open the door. 4. Close the door and press the Start/ Pause again. The delay start continues to operate. Open the appliance door when the programme operates: 1. Turn the programme knob to Ein/ Aus position to deactivate the appliance. 2. Wait for some minutes and then open the appliance door. 3. Close the appliance door. 4.

www.aeg.com Always obey the instructions that you find on the packaging of the product. 11.3 Maintenance wash With the low temperature programmes it is possible that some detergent stays in the drum. Make regularly a maintenance wash. To do this: • Remove the laundry from the drum. • Set the cotton programme with the highest temperature with a small quantity of detergent. 11.4 Door seal Regularly examine the seal and remove all objects from the inner part. 11.5 Cleaning the detergent dispenser 1.

www.aeg.com Problem Possible solution Make sure that the connection of the water inlet hose is correct. The appliance does not drain the water. Make sure that the sink spigot is not clogged. Make sure that the drain hose has no kinks or bends. Make sure that the drain filter is not clogged. Clean the filter, if necessary. Refer to 'Care and cleaning'. Make sure that the connection of the drain hose is correct. Set the drain programme if you set a programme without drain phase.
